ARDUINO A000110 4 Relay Shield Korisničko uputstvo

4 LED Example:
Ovaj exampLe pokazuje kako da upravljate uključivanjem 4 LED-a sa 4 releja.
Napomena:
U ovom exampkoriste se 4 LED diode za demonstraciju rada štita sa 4 releja, ali možete se povezati na releje drugih vrsta opterećenja i kreirati svoju personaliziranu skicu.
hardver:
- Arduino ploča
- Arduino 4 relejni štit
- 4 LED
- 4 otpornik 220Ω
- Žice
Krug:
Postavite štit od 4 releja na Arduino ploču, povežite "Zajedničke" kontakte (C) releja na pin za napajanje "5V" štita.
Povežite sve anode LED dioda (obično duži pin) u seriju na otpornik od 220Ω i povežite ih na “Normally Open” kontakt (NO) releja.
Također povežite katode LED-a na uzemljenje (GND) štita.
Konačno povežite ploču sa računarom pomoću USB kabla i učitajte skicu.
Sada možete upravljati svakim pojedinačnim LED-om pomoću releja koji je povezan.
kod:
Ova skica pilotira 4 LED-a.
Prvo uključuje LED1 povezanu sa relejem1, nakon jedne sekunde pali led2 povezanu sa relejem2, prekorači drugu sekundu uključuje led3 povezanu sa relejem3 i na kraju, nakon jedne sekunde, uključuje LED4 na koji je povezan relej4.
Relej 1 se upravlja sa pina 4, relej 2 sa pina 7, relej 3 sa 8 i relej 4 sa pina 12.
Komutacijom se naređuje funkcija “digitalWrite()”.
Kada su releji postavljeni na LOW, “Common” (C) kontakt je spojen na “Normally Closed” (NC) kontakt.
Umjesto toga, kada su releji postavljeni na HIGH, “Common” (C) kontakt se prebacuje i povezuje na “Normally Open” (NO) kontakt.
Evo možete preuzeti šemu štita sa 4 releja.
Kompletan kod i njegov detaljan opis prikazani su dolje.
/*4-releji štit Example*/
//definiraj varijablu
int RELEJ1 = 4;
int RELEJ2 = 7;
int RELEJ3 = 8;
int RELEJ4 = 12;
void setup()
{
//postavimo releje kao izlaz
pinMode(RELEJ1, IZLAZ);
pinMode(RELEJ2, IZLAZ);
pinMode(RELEJ3, IZLAZ);
pinMode(RELEJ4, IZLAZ);
void setup()
{
//postavimo releje kao izlaz
pinMode(RELEJ1, IZLAZ);
pinMode(RELEJ2, IZLAZ);
pinMode(RELEJ3, IZLAZ);
pinMode(RELEJ4, IZLAZ);
}
void loop()
{
digitalWrite(RELAY1,HIGH); // Uključuje LED1
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Y2,HIGH); // Uključuje LED2
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Y3,HIGH); // Uključuje LED3
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Y4,HIGH); // Uključuje LED4
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Y4,LOW); // Isključuje LED4
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Y3,LOW); // Isključuje LED3
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Y2,LOW); // Isključuje LED2
kašnjenje (1000); // Pričekajte 1 sekunde
digitalWrite(RELAY1,LOW); // Isključuje LED1
kašnjenje (1000); // Pričekajte 1 sekunde
}

Referentni dizajni DAJU SE “KAKVI JESU” I “SA SVIM GREŠKAMA”. Arduino SE ODRIČE SVIH DRUGIH GARANCIJA, IZRIČITIH ILI PODRAZUMEVANIH, Arduino može izvršiti promjene u specifikacijama i opisima proizvoda u bilo koje vrijeme, bez prethodne najave. Kupac ne smije
U VEZI PROIZVODA, UKLJUČUJUĆI, ALI NE OGRANIČUJUĆI SE NA, BILO KAKVE IMPLICIRANE GARANCIJE O PRODAJNOSTI ILI PRIKLADNOSTI ZA ODREĐENU NAMJENU, oslanjaju se na odsustvo ili karakteristike bilo kojih karakteristika ili uputstava označenih kao “rezervisano” ili “nedefinirano”. Arduino ih zadržava za buduću definiciju i neće imati nikakvu odgovornost za sukobe ili nekompatibilnosti koje proizlaze iz budućih promjena na njima.
Informacije o proizvodu na Web Sajt ili materijali su podložni promenama bez prethodne najave. Nemojte finalizirati dizajn s ovim informacijama.
Naziv i logotip “Arduino” su zaštitni znaci registrovani od strane Arduino Srl u Italiji, Evropskoj uniji i drugim zemljama svijeta.

Dokumenti / Resursi
![]() |
ARDUINO A000110 4 relejni štit [pdf] Korisnički priručnik A000110, A000110 4 releja štit, A000110, 4 releja štit, relejski štit, štit |




